Freckenham Road is in West Row, Bury St. Edmunds and in Forest Heath district. IP28 8PX is located in the Manor elect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of West Suffolk.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. The area surrounding IP28 8PX has a slightly higher male population, with 50.1% of residents being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a high perc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(86.9%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either a younger population or more affluent area.

Safety

Is Freckenham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Freckenham Road was 94.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 195.1% higher than the Lakenheath average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Freckenham Road has the 2nd highest crime rate of 52 local areas in Lakenheath and the 102nd highest crime rate of 587 local areas in West Suffolk .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 56.9 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 41.4%.
